2010-07-22 81 views
3

我的應用程序的一部分包括一個「聊天」系統。我爲每個用戶維護一個隊列。發送給用戶的消息放入隊列中,用戶的軟件定期輪詢休息服務中是否有新消息,此時隊列中會收到消息,並將消息返回給用戶。管理大量的Azure隊列

該系統是非常簡單的,效果很好,並做了所有我需要做的。

我的問題是;我有數百(甚至數千)的隊列將應用程序的隊列列表弄亂。

我有其他隊列爲好,這是令人不安的,我認爲我不能「組織」他們就像我可以在Blob存儲的東西。

我缺少的東西,或者我應該只是忽略隊列列表中,並依賴於一個事實,即我在妥善管理隊列的創建和刪除,因爲用戶來來去去?

回答

3

我只是忽視的事實列表是雜亂。 Blob存在於容器中,但隊列沒有容器。一切都是平坦的清單。

除非你想以某種方式查詢隊列,平板名單應該不會打擾你。如果你確實需要查詢隊列(比如「最近使用過的」或類似的東西),你可能需要保留一個包含隊列列表和一些屬性的表格,以便查詢。

+0

這幾乎是我想的......感謝您的確認:) – Steve 2010-07-23 00:49:45